Sonic the Hedgehog to Become the Justice League in New Crossover Comic

Five-issue series set to debut in March 2025

During the annual Sonic Central Stream, Tiffany Smith sat down with Head of SEGA Brands, Ivo Gerscovich to discuss a video SEGA released for this year’s Batman Day. The animation shows a crimina running through the streets of Gothamas the Bat Signal shines. After retreating to a darkened alleyway, the criminal is approached by an obscured figure from the darkness.But instead of Batman leaping out, it’s Sonic’s rival Shadow the Hedgehog, dressed as the Dark Knight.

Gerscovich revealed that the video was just one part of a collaboration with DC Comics and that the two companies were working together to create a full-length comic miniseries that would start in March 2025. While Gerscovich remained mum on the details, he did confirm that Ian Flynn would return to pen the crossover event. Gerscovich also confirmed that fans would see theSonic characters working alongside the Justice League in the future series.

After expressing appreciation for Shadow’s mashup, Smith inquired about other potential amalgamations. Gerscovich confirmed that in the series, readers would see Knuckles as Superman, Amy as Wonder Woman, Tails as Cyborg, and Silver as Green Lantern.Sonic, of course, will be the Flash, a mashup that Smith appreciated even more than Shadow as Batman. Gerscovich closed out the announcements by revealing that fall 2025 would see Sonic/DC merchandise (including a collected edition of the comic series) and that the collaboration would extend through 2026.
